About This Community
Harperwoods HOA is a planned community in Beaverton, Oregon (ZIP 97003). The HOA fee is $200 per month. On-site amenities include Pool, Clubhouse. Long-term rentals are allowed, but short-term / Airbnb-style rentals are not permitted. The community is pet-friendly.
HOA Rules & Restrictions
Pet Restrictions
Max 2 pets, dogs under 50 lbs
Parking Rules
2 car garage required, guest parking on street
